CHAPTER VIII MARY SHARES ALL GIFTS WITH THE LORD

"
Ave
Maria
,
gratia
plena
,
Dominus
tecum
." It has been
shown
above how
Mary
, because of the
purity
of her
life
, is
rightly
saluted
by the
Ave
. It has also been
shown
how, because of the
abundance
of her
graces
, she is
rightly
called
"
full
of
grace
." We have now to
show
how, because of a most
special
presence
of
God
within her, it is
rightly
said
to her: "The
Lord
is with thee." But
tell
us, in what
measure
,
O
great
Gabriel
, thou
bringest
tidings
of a
great
thing
to the
great
Mary
from the
great
God
! But
tell
us, in what
measure
, or how He is with her ?
Behold
St
.
Augustine
answering
this
question
, as it were in the
person
of
Gabriel
: "The
Lord
is with thee, but more than with me. The
Lord
is with thee, but not as He is with me. For although the
Lord
is in me, the
Lord
hath
created
me; but by thee the
Lord
is to be
born
." The
Lord
, therefore,
O
Mary
, but who, how
great
? The
Lord
of the
earth
and of all
things
in
general
, the
Lord
who is
especially
the
Lord
of
mankind
, the
Lord
who is thine in a
singular
manner
,
O
Mary
. The
Lord
, I
say
, of all
creatures
in
general
, the
Lord
in a
special
manner
of
rational
creatures
, the
Lord
especially
of thy
virginal
court
,
O
Mary
. We must
consider
, therefore, that this
Lord
, who is with thee, is in
general
the
Lord
of all
creatures
.
Judith
says
: "The
Lord
of the
heavens
, the
Creator
of the
waters
, and the
Lord
of all
creatures
" (
IX
,
17
.) And the
Wise
Man
: "The
Lord
of all
things
loved
her" (
Wisd
.
VIII
,
3
.) Therefore, the
Lord
of all
things
universally
, of all
things
visible
and
invisible
. This
universal
Lord
of all
things
was in
Mary
in such a
manner
that He made her the
universal
Lady
of all
things-the
Lady
, I
say
, of
Heaven
, and the
Lady
of the
world
.
St
.
Anselm
saith
: "The
Queen
of
heaven
, and the
Lady
of the
World
, to the
Mother
of Him, who
cleanseth
the
world
, I
confess
that my
body
is
exceedingly
impure
." But
lo
! this
universal
Lord
of all
things
is a most
powerful
Lord
, a most
wise
Lord
, a most
rich
Lord
, a most
unfailing
Lord
. A
lord
without
power
, without
wisdom
, without
wealth
, without
permanence
, would be a most
imperfect
lord
. A
feeble
lord
, one
needy
and
insipid
, or
unable
to
keep
his
position
, would be
little
esteemed
. But Our
Lord
is
universal
, most
powerful
, most
wise
, most
wealthy
; His
eternity
is
unfailing
.
First
note
that the
universal
Lord
, who is with
Mary
, is a
Lord
most
powerful
in will, and it is well
said
of Him: "All
whatsoever
the
Lord
hath
willed
, the
Lord
has done, . . . even in all
abysses
" (
Ps
.
CXXXIV
,
6
.) Therefore, neither in
Heaven
, nor on
earth
, nor in all the
infernal
abysses
, can anyone
resist
the will of so
powerful
a
Lord
, as
Mardochai
testifies
,
saying
: "
Lord
King
Almighty
, in thy
dominion
are all
things
, and there is none who can
resist
thy will" (
Esth
.
XIII
,
9
.)
Behold
,
Mary
, how
great
, how
powerful
is the
Lord
who is with thee! And because He is a most
powerful
Lord
, He is most
powerfully
with thee: therefore,
art
thou most
powerful
with Him, by Him, through Him, so that thou
canst
truly
say
, "My
power
is in
Jerusalem
" (
Ecclus
.
XXIV
,
15
. )
Jerusalem
signifies
the
Church
triumphant
in
Heaven
; it
signifies
also the
Church
militant
upon
earth
. For
truly
both in
Heaven
and on
earth
the
Mother
of the
Creator
has
power
. How very
powerful
she is,
Anselm
recognizes
when he
says
: "
Hear
us,
loving
one; be with us, be
favorable
to us;
help
us, most
powerful
one, that our
minds
may
be
cleansed
from
stains
and our
darkness
illuminated
." The
Lord
, therefore, is with thee,
O
most
powerful
Mary
.
Secondly
,
note
that the
universal
Lord
, who is with
Mary
, is a
Lord
most
wise
in
truth
. For He is the
Lord
, of whom it is
said
in the
Psalm
, "
Great
is our
Lord
, and
great
is His
strength
, and of His
wisdom
there is no
number
" (
Ps
.
CXLVI
,
5
. )
Oh
, how
wise
is the
Lord
, whose
wisdom
nothing can
deceive
, nothing can be
concealed
from, because He
knows
all
things
. All our
works
, both
good
and
bad
, all our
words
,
good
and
bad
, all our
thoughts
and all our
desires
,
good
and
bad
, the
Lord
knows
. Whence
St
.
Peter
says
: "
Lord
, Thou
knowest
all
things
."
Behold
,
Mary
, what
kind
of a
Lord
, what a most
wise
Lord
, is He who is with thee. And because the most
wise
Lord
is most
wisely
with thee, therefore, thou too
art
most
wise
with Him and through Him. Thou
art
typified
by that
Abigail
, of whom it was
said
: "She was a
woman
most
prudent
and most
beautiful
."
Mary
was so
prudent
and so
beautiful
that
St
.
Anselm
does not
hesitate
to
say
of her: "All the
treasures
of
wisdom
and
knowledge
are in
Mary
." The
Lord
, therefore, is with thee,
O
most
wise
Mary
.
Thirdly
,
consider
that the
universal
Lord
, who is with
Mary
, is most
wealthy
in His
possessions
, as the
Prophet
testifies
,
saying
: "The
earth
is the
Lord
's, and all that
dwell
in it." Not only is the
earth
and its
fullness
the
Lord
's, but also the
Heavens
and their
fullness
. For Thine,
O
Lord
, are the
Heavens
, and thine is the
earth
, because "the
heaven
of
heavens
is the
Lord
's." Everything is the
property
of this
Lord
,
Heaven
and
earth
,
bodies
and
spirits
, all
nature
, all
grace
, all
heavenly
glory
, all is the
Lord
's own. Therefore, the
Lord
is most
rich
, as the
Apostle
says
: "He is the
Lord
of all,
rich
unto all that
call
upon Him" (
Rom
.
X
,
12
.)
Behold
,
Mary
, how
rich
, how
great
is He who is with thee ! And because the most
rich
lord
is with thee so
richly
, therefore
art
thou most
rich
together with Him and because of Him, so that it can be
truly
said
of thee: "Many
daughters
have
gathered
together
riches
, thou hast
surpassed
them all" (
Prov
.
XXXI
,
29
.) The
daughter
Agnes
, the
daughter
Lucy
, the
daughters
Catherine
,
Cecilia
,
Agatha
, and many other
holy
virgins
and
just
souls
, have
gathered
together
riches
of
virtue
and
grace
, of
merits
and
rewards
, but thou,
O
Mary
, by thy
universal
riches
hast
surpassed
them all.
Oh
, how
rich
is
Mary
in
glory
, who was so
rich
in
misery
!
Oh
, how
rich
is she in
Heaven
, who was so
rich
in this
world
!
Oh
, how
rich
is she in her
soul
, who was so
rich
in her
body
, that even
St
.
Bernard
exclaims
: "
O
Mary
,
rich
in all and above all, of whose
substance
a
small
part
being
taken
, was enough to
pay
the
debt
of the whole
world
!" The
Lord
is with thee, therefore,
O
Mary
most
rich
.
Fourthly
,
consider
that the
universal
Lord
, who is with
Mary
, is the
unfailing
Lord
of
eternity
. Whence we
read
in
Exodus
: "The
Lord
will
reign
in
eternity
and beyond." And in the
Psalm
it is
said
: "But thou,
O
Lord
,
remainest
for ever."
Behold
,
O
Mary
, how
great
a
Lord
, how
unfailing
a
Lord
is He who is with thee ! And because He is
unfailingly
with thee, therefore, thou also
art
unfailing
with Him in
eternity
. For thou
art
that
unfailing
, that
everlasting
throne
, the
throne
of the
Son
of
God
, of whom the
Father
saith
by the
Prophet
: "His
throne
is like the
sun
in my
sight
, and like the
moon
perfect
for ever and
truly
in
eternity
." Hence, we cannot only
say
with
truth
: "Thou,
O
Lord
,
endurest
for ever," but we can also
truly
say
: "Thou,
O
Lady
,
endurest
for ever." What
wonder
if
Mary
, in her
Son
,
remains
forever
, when even the
benefits
of
Mary
in her
servants
remain
forever
? For
St
.
Bernard
says
: "In thee,
O
Mary
,
angels
find
joy
, the
just
grace
,
sinners
pardon
forever
." The
Lord
, therefore, is with thee,
O
neverfailing
Mary
!
Rejoice
,
O
Mary
,
rejoice
!
Behold
the most
powerful
Lord
is with thee in such a
manner
that thou
art
most
powerful
with Him. The most
wise
Lord
is with thee in such a
way
that thou
art
most
wise
with Him. The most
rich
Lord
is with thee in such
wise
that thou
art
most
rich
with Him. The
never-failing
Lord
is with thee in such
wise
that thou, together with Him, shalt never
fail
or be
deficient
.
Now, therefore, most
powerful
Lady
, be a
helper
to us who are so
impotent
! Now, most
wise
Lady
, be to us who are
foolish
a
helper
and a
counselor
!
O
most
wealthy
Lady
, be to us who are
poor
a
benefactress
!
O
most
unfailing
Lady
, be to us
feeble
,
failing
creatures
a
perpetual
support
in every
good
deed
!
